About Mother Teresa Women's University Dindigul

Mother Teresa Women's University, established in 1984, is a state university located in Kodaikanal, Tamil Nadu. Founded by the Government of Tamil Nadu under Act 15, it is dedicated exclusively to women's education and empowerment. The university operates under the affiliation of the Tamil Nadu government and is named in honor of Nobel Laureate Mother Teresa.

The university holds an 'A' grade accreditation from NAAC and is ranked 46th among Indian universities by NIRF in 2024. It offers a wide range of undergraduate, postgraduate, and doctoral programs across arts, science, management, education, and women’s studies. With a campus spread over 52 acres, MTWU emphasizes academic excellence, research, and personality development, serving over 8,000 students with a strong faculty base.

Admission Process

Admission to Mother Teresa Women's University, Dindigul, is primarily merit-based for most undergraduate and postgraduate courses, with some programs requiring entrance exams like TANCET or university-specific tests. Applications can be submitted online or offline through the official university portal or designated centers.

UG Admission

Steps to Apply

  1. Visit the official website and click on "Apply Online".
  2. Select your preferred study center (Madurai, Kodaikanal, Chennai, Coimbatore, or Madurai).
  3. Choose the desired undergraduate course and verify eligibility (10+2 pass with required percentage).
  4. Fill in personal and academic details in the application form.
  5. Pay the application fee (₹60 for application, ₹75 for registration) online or offline.
  6. Submit the completed application form online or at the selected center.
  7. Wait for the merit list based on qualifying exam marks for admission confirmation.

PG Admission (MBA, MCA, M.Sc., etc.)

Steps to Apply

  1. Check eligibility for the postgraduate course (Bachelor’s degree with minimum required percentage).
  2. Register and apply online via the university website or offline at designated centers.
  3. Appear for the entrance exam if applicable (TANCET or university entrance test for MBA/MCA).
  4. Attend the interview or counseling session if required.
  5. Pay the application and registration fees as specified.
  6. Submit all required documents along with the application.
  7. Admission is granted based on merit list prepared from entrance exam scores and qualifying marks.

Scholarships & Financial Aid

Mother Teresa Women's University offers various scholarships primarily for SC/ST, Most Backward Classes, Denotified Communities, economically disadvantaged students, and those with special categories such as sports quota, physically handicapped, and single girl children. Scholarships include fee concessions, merit-based awards, and government-sponsored schemes, with additional support for M.Phil and Ph.D. scholars.

Campus & Infrastructure

Mother Teresa Women's University is located in Attuvampatti near Kodaikanal, Tamil Nadu, nestled in the scenic Palani hills. The campus offers a serene environment with well-maintained infrastructure including modern classrooms, a large library, and dedicated hostels for girls, supporting a focused academic atmosphere.
